Canonical

IoT/Data Platform Engineer

Canonical

Overview

Role involves developing IoT telemetry and connectivity solutions in a remote setting.

Ideal candidate has strong backend development skills and experience with data streaming technologies.

Location: EMEA region only

remotemidpermanentfull-timeEnglishPythonGolangKafkaRabbitMQ

Locations

  • EMEA

Requirements

  • Bachelor's in Computer Science or similar
  • Experience with data streaming technologies
  • Proficiency in Python and/or Golang

Responsibilities

  • Collaborate with a global team
  • Architect scalable service APIs
  • Develop data governance systems
  • Work with infrastructure team
  • Design and implement features
  • Review code and designs
  • Discuss ideas and solutions
  • Travel for events

Benefits

  • Personal learning budget
  • Annual compensation review
  • Maternity and paternity leave
  • Team Member Assistance Program
  • Opportunity to travel
  • Recognition rewards
  • Annual holiday leave
  • Distributed work environment